Strategic Placement for Better Visual Hierarchy
One common mistake in web design is overusing decorative fonts. Signature Men is a display font, meaning it demands attention. It is best suited for hero titles, section headings, short phrases, and logo text. It is not designed for body copy. If you try to use it for long paragraphs, you will frustrate your users and hurt your readability scores. In my workflow, I reserve this typeface for moments that need emphasis. For example, on a course sales page, I might use it for the main value proposition or a testimonial highlight, while keeping the detailed curriculum description in a clean, legible sans serif font.
Readability is crucial for user engagement. On mobile screens, script fonts can become illegible if the size is too small or the line height is too tight. When testing Signature Men for responsive layouts, I ensure that the font size scales appropriately. On smaller devices, I increase the letter spacing slightly to prevent the flowing characters from merging into one another. This small adjustment ensures that the font remains beautiful and functional across all devices. For dark backgrounds, I recommend using a lighter weight or ensuring high contrast with white or light-colored text to maintain clarity.
Pairing Strategies for a Cohesive Brand Identity
A great script font never works in isolation. It needs a partner. For Signature Men, I typically pair it with a neutral sans serif font for body copy. This combination creates a modern typography stack that feels both contemporary and timeless. The simplicity of the sans serif allows the script to shine without overwhelming the user. In editorial design contexts, you might pair it with a classic serif font to create a more sophisticated, magazine-like feel. However, for most digital product creators and SaaS founders, the sans serif pairing offers the best balance of professionalism and creativity.
Consider a portfolio homepage. The designer’s name in Signature Men immediately establishes a personal brand, while the project descriptions in a clean sans serif ensure that potential clients can scan the information quickly. This hierarchy supports scanning behavior, allowing users to grasp the main message instantly before diving into the details. Consistency in these pairings builds brand trust. When visitors see the same typographic logic across your landing pages, social media graphics, and email newsletters, they perceive your brand as reliable and well-managed.
Technical Considerations for Web Implementation
Before launching any new typeface on a client project, I always check the technical specifications. Signature Men comes with various styles and alternates that can add variety to your design assets. Check if the font package includes webfont formats like WOFF or WOFF2, which are optimized for fast-loading visual content on websites. Slow-loading fonts can negatively impact user experience and SEO rankings. Ensuring that the font files are properly compressed and hosted is part of responsible web design.
Licensing is another critical factor. Since Signature Men is available through Script Amp, verify the commercial font licensing terms before using it on online stores, digital templates, or client websites. Some licenses cover personal use only, while others allow for broader commercial applications. Understanding these boundaries protects both you and your clients from legal issues. Additionally, check for multilingual support if your target audience spans different regions. A font that supports special characters and accents ensures inclusivity and broader reach.
